Let’s Talk Food: Where Breakfast and Dinner Share the Spotlight
If you're the kind of person who believes that breakfast shouldn't have a curfew, you're in for a treat. They serve an all-day breakfast that sits somewhere between wholesome and heavenly. Think buttery sourdough with smashed avo that’s not overly fussy, and poached eggs that are actually poached properly (you know what I mean).
Now, if it's dinner you're there for—do not, I repeat, do not skip their pizzas. The kind with a perfectly blistered crust, fresh local ingredients, and that smoky goodness only real wood fires deliver. My top pick? Try the pumpkin and prosciutto with feta. It hits that salty-sweet balance you didn’t know your taste buds were missing.
Sip and Stay Awhile
The wine selection at The Vault is another level. They’ve kept things local—small-batch, regional vinos that pair perfectly with everything on the menu. Whether you’re a red fanatic or a sparkling sipper, there’s something here that’ll make you want that second glass (or bottle… no judgement here).
And their coffee? Barista-made perfection. I don’t say that lightly. If you take your flat white seriously, this is your place.
